Loosely based on the classic 17th-century erotic novel The Carnal Prayer Mat , Sex and Zen is the most famous Hong Kong erotic film of all time. It tells the story of a young scholar who seeks ultimate sensual pleasure, leading to a series of bizarre sexual encounters and a famously absurd surgical operation involving a horse. The film broke box office records and features incredible martial arts choreography alongside its adult themes. 8. | Film (Year) | Director | Why It’s Cat III | Legacy | |-------------|----------|------------------|---------| | (1993) | Herman Yau | Realistic violence, social anger (taxi driver kills rude cabbies) | Anthony Wong again; a dark satire of HK customer service rage. | | Run and Kill (1993) | Billy Tang | Graphic amputation, child endangerment, home invasion | One of the most disturbing non-supernatural thrillers ever made in HK. | | Red to Kill (1994) | Billy Tang | Rape, institutional abuse, mental disability exploitation | Extremely bleak; pushed Cat III limits for social “message” about halfway houses. |
